The month of March is designated as Women’s History Month to honor women’s contribution to American Society.

Advertisement

Observed throughout the United States, it was first proclaimed Women’s History Week by President Jimmy Carter in 1980. Then in 1987, Congress designated the month as Women’s History followed by presidential proclamations every year.

All of this was born out of a feminist push for equal access to jobs and education, which was one of the demands of the Strike for Equality march by more than 100,000 women (and some men) in New York on August 26, 1970.

At the time there was an International Women’s Day which commemorated a February meeting of Socialists and Suffragettes in February 1909. This day is observed every March 8.
